  2. Just on the clone bit you was saying when you take them to make a mother make sure you put your clone in a smaller pot then let that fill out. Then pot up accordingly then into final pot. You need a really good root ball and strong roots ready to take up much nuets and water and make sure you feed it a nuet that will reduce shock from taking clones etc.
    Also 6.8 is little high I'd lower that to 5.8 to 6 well that's just my opinion others may say different. I always use airpots also for my mother's just gives them roots more air and a better root structure hope this helps buddy keep me informed. :D

  4. Haha no worries pal hope all goes well just think tho if you doing a mother the roots need to be bang on so every bit of space in that pot counts. So potting up is a must to get that root ball perfect. Then the airpot at the end will air prune all the tips and make the roots explode inside making more feeder roots. That's how they work airpots you see they air prune the tips look them up properly and it tells you how they work it stops the roots from circling the pots and fills out the middle..perfect for mother plants if you ask me pal.
